JUST-IN: Borno Commissioner Found Dead In His Room

The Borno State Commissioner of Finance, Ahmed Ali Ahmed is dead.

The late commissioner died at the age of 44 years.

The state’s Commissioner of Information and Internal Secretary, Prof Usman Tar, in a statement announcing the death of the commissioner said he died Monday morning in his house.

The statement reads, “Borno State Government wishes to announce the death of Ahmed Ali Ahmed, the State Commissioner of Finance.”

Prof Tar said the deceased will be buried later on Monday at his family house on Damboa Road.

The statement however did not disclose the cause of the Commissioner’s death.

Sources close to the deceased said he died inside his room, adding that his room’s door was forced open when he exceeded his time of coming out before his corpse was later found inside the room.

LEADERSHIP reports that the late Commissioner of Finance died 10 months after the demise of the former Commissioner of Reconstruction, Rehabilitation and Resettlement (RRR), late Ibrahim Garba, who was found dead in a guest house.
